General Information

Title: O vos omnes
Composer: Carlo Gesualdo

Number of voices: 6vv  Voicing: SSATTB
Genre: Sacred, Motets
Language: Latin
Instruments: none, a cappella
Published: Gesualdo, 1611

Original text and translations

Original text:
O vos omnes qui transitis per viam,
attendite et videte,
si est dolor similis sicut dolor meus.

Versus: Attendite, universi populi, et videte dolorem meum.
